1. About Aposentadoria Law in Luanda, Angola

Aposentadoria, or retirement law, in Luanda is governed by the national social security framework of Angola. The system covers formal sector workers and provides several pension types, including old-age, disability, and survivors’ pensions. In Luanda, residents use local social security offices to file applications and appeals, often with support from a lawyer or legal advisor to navigate forms and deadlines.

The legal framework blends legislation on social security with regulations on employment and labor standards. Eligibility generally depends on a minimum contribution period and age, with variations for workers in different sectors. Practical administration is handled through the competent national bodies, which issue payment decisions and manage ongoing pension rights. For up-to-date texts, consult official government sources and the gazette for amendments and new rules.

3. Local Laws Overview

The main legal anchors for Aposentadoria in Angola include the following named instruments:

  • Lei da Segurança Social (Law on Social Security) - governs pension types, eligibility, and contributions for formal workers; establishes the rights to old-age, disability, and survivors’ benefits.
  • Regulamento da Segurança Social (Regulation of Social Security) - details procedures, calculation rules, and administrative processes for applying and appealing decisions.
  • Código do Trabalho (Labor Code) - affects employer obligations on contributions, payroll practices, and the relationship between employment status and pension eligibility.

Recent changes to these instruments are published in the Diário da República and are implemented over time. For precise texts and dates, consult official sources such as the Government Portal and the official gazette. When planning a retirement or handling a dispute, verify the exact articles and transitional provisions that apply to your situation.

4. Frequently Asked Questions

What is the basic eligibility for Aposentadoria in Angola?

Eligibility typically depends on a minimum contribution period and age under the Lei da Segurança Social. Specific thresholds vary by sector and regime, so check your contribution history and the official texts.

How do I apply for an old-age pension in Luanda?

Submit the application through the local social security office with documents proving identity, employment history, and contributions. A lawyer can help assemble and organize the required paperwork.

When can I retire under Angola's pension rules?

Retirement age and the possibility of early retirement depend on your registration under the social security regime and your contribution record. Review the current statutes to confirm your precise age and conditions.

Where do I file my retirement or appeal documents in Luanda?

Applications and appeals are filed at designated social security offices in Luanda or through official online portals if available. A legal professional can guide you to the correct office and deadlines.

Why was my pension application denied and what can I do?

Common reasons include incomplete records, missing contributions, or non-eligibility under the current regime. An attorney can review the decision, request reconsideration, and, if needed, pursue an appeal.

Can I calculate my pension amount by myself?

Basic calculations can be estimated from your contribution history and salary data. However, official calculations require access to internal actuarial formulas held by the social security authority.

Should I hire a lawyer for pension appeals?

Yes if you face a denial, a complex calculation, or cross-border contributions. A lawyer can interpret the law, gather evidence, and represent you in hearings or courts.

Do I need to contribute for a minimum period to qualify?

Most pension schemes require a minimum number of contribution years, but specific requirements depend on your work category and regime. Check the current law for precise numbers.

Is there early retirement in Angola?

Early retirement rules exist under certain conditions, usually tied to specific contribution levels or disability status. A lawyer can assess your scenario for eligibility and consequences.

How long does the appeal process take in Luanda?

Processing times vary by caseload and complexity of the case. A lawyer can provide a realistic timeline based on recent Luanda precedents and the relevant office.

What is the difference between old-age and disability pension?

Old-age pensions rely on age and contribution history, while disability pensions hinge on medical status and functional impairment. Both require different documentation and proof of eligibility.
